Spark plug removal
I was going to change the plugs and wires on my '99 Silverado (5.3L engine)this weekend. I was using a standard socket wrench with spark plug socket. I put the socket on the first plug and applied what I thought would be enough force to break it loose, but it didn't budge. I put a little more force on it and still nothing. At that point, I started getting a little nervous and decided to stop. These are the original plugs with 92,000 miles on them. Any advice on getting these babies loose? Is there a danger of breaking the plug off in the engine if I apply too much force?

Re: Spark plug removal
You could spray some PB Blaster to get into the threads. Once you get them out, don't forget to put a dab of anti-sieze on the threads of the new plugs.
